The present invention describes a new class of heterobimetallic chabazites that exhibit excellent NOX reduction under NH3-SCR conditions in 150-650 °C range. The new compositions retain their activity even after hydrothermal aging.

The present invention for making graphene was developed for atmospheric pressure conditions in contrast to conventional methods, which employ a low pressure deposition. Atmospheric deposition conditions constitute a major advantage for synthesis of continuous graphene sheets.
